Synthesis Structural And Hydrolytic Studies Of Zinc(li) Complex Of Nnbis (2-aminophenyl) -24-diiminopentane

In this study the synthesis of[N, N' -bis (2-chloroquinoxaline-3-yl)-1 ,3-diaminopropanernand the synthesis, structure and hydrolytic activity of a zinc(lI) complex of N,N'-bis (2-rnaminophenyl)-2,4-diiminopentane are presented.rnIn the first part attempt was made to synthesize a macrocyclic ligand derived fromrn2,3-dichloroquinoxaline and diamine. The reaction between 2,3-dichloroquinoxalinernand excess 1 ,3-diaminopropane led to the formation of a pale yellowish solid. The IR,rn1H NMR and 13N MR of the compound indicated that it is a non-cyclic molecule.rnThe reaction of 1,2-phenylenediamine with acetylacetone in water resulted in thernformation of a ligand that forms a complex with zinc(lI) ion. The complex wasrncharacterized by lH NMR, 13e NMR, IR, conductivity measurement, etc. Thernpreliminary test indicated that rate enhancement by the complex on the hydrolysis ofrntri (p-nitrophenyl) phosphate, p-nitrophenylacetate and 4-nitrophenylbenzoate is inrndecreasing order, in 10% (H20) aq. acetonitrile at 35°e and above.
